Redwood Shores, CA, USA – February 9, 2012
Oracle today announced that it has entered into an
agreement to acquire Taleo Corporation (NASDAQ:TLEO),
a leading provider of cloud-based talent management for $46.00 per share or approximately $1.9 billion, net of Taleo’s cash and debt.

Taleo’s Talent Management Cloud helps organizations attract, develop, motivate and retain human capital to improve performance and drive growth.
Together, Oracle and Taleo expect to create a comprehensive cloud offering for organizations to manage their Human Resource operations and employee careers.

The Board of Directors of Taleo has unanimously approved the transaction.
The transaction is expected to close mid-year 2012, subject to Taleo stockholder approval, certain regulatory approvals and other customary closing conditions.

About Taleo
Taleo (NASDAQ: TLEO)
helps organizations improve the performance of their business by unlocking the power of their people.
• Taleo is a leading provider of cloud-based talent management software that helps organizations attract, develop, motivate and retain human capital to improve business performance and drive growth
• Headquartered in Dublin, CA, USA, with over 1,400 employees worldwide
• Over 5,000 enterprises of all sizes rely on Taleo across many industries
• Taleo’s cloud manages 15% of all US hires and is one of the world’s largest cloud deployments with nearly 16 billion transactions per year

Oracle and Taleo
Complementary Talent Management and Human Capital Management Solutions
Taleo brings complementary solutions to the Oracle Public Cloud:
• Taleo brings leading Talent Management solutions to the Oracle Public Cloud
• Oracle offers best-in-class Cloud services: Fusion Human Capital Management, Fusion ERP, Fusion Sales and Marketing, Oracle RightNow Service, Oracle Social Network, Database Service, Java Service, Data Service and Security Service
• Oracle’s BI and Middleware can offer value to Taleo’s customers
• Oracle’s and Taleo’s solutions together enable enterprises to establish best practices across all Human Capital activities, accelerate adoption, and quickly create value.
Taleo is a leading provider of cloud- based talent management solutions:
• 15% of all US hires flow through Taleo, processing up to 74 million transactions per day
• Nearly half of the top 30 career sites in the world are powered by Taleo
• 240 million candidates are on Taleo Talent Exchange, a marketplace for sourcing candidates
• Experienced team with specialized skills for developing, selling, servicing, operating and supporting talent management cloud solutions.

Prior to joining Taleo, Michael Gregoire served as executive vice president of Global Services for PeopleSoft, an enterprise software company in nearby Pleasanton.
Gregoire has also served as executive director of the EDS New York Information Solutions Organization, based in New York City.
The Information Solutions Organization business was a $500M+ in annual revenue unit focused on aligning technology and operations with business strategy.
Gregoire has a Master's degree from California Coast University and holds a Bachelor of Science degree from Wilfrid Laurier University in Ontario, Canada.
He has been named one of Consulting Magazine's "Top 25 Most Influential Consultants."
